Matteo Berrettini was eliminated in the quarterfinals of Challenger Phoenix 2023 by the Russian Shevchenko, number 136 in the world, 6-4, 3-6, 6-3.

Bad defeat for Matteo Berrettini who abandons the Challenger Phoenix 2023 adventure in the quarter-finals, losing against the Russian Alexander Shevchenko who won 6-4, 3-6, 6-3. A bad stop for the blue against the number 136 in the world ranking.

Thus continues the adventure of the Russian who, after Gael Monfils and Marc-Andrea Huesler, has had the whim of eliminating Matteo Berrettini, the number one seed in the tournament. A game in which the blue too often appeared in difficulty and which partially confirmed a non-optimal mental condition.
